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: 1. Male and female participants aged equal to or more than 18 years and equal to or less than 50 years at the time of consent. 2. Participants who can and are willing to provide Informed Consent. 3. Participants who understand and are willing to participate in the clinical study and can comply with CIP requirements. 4. Participants that are non-smokers. 5. Participants having dark pigmentation (Type IV -VI on Fitzpatrick pigmentation scale) 6. Presence of both normal upper limbs.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: 1. Participants less than 18 years or more than 50 years of age. 2.Participants considered as being morbidly obese (defined as BMI more than 39.5). 3.Participants with compromised circulation, injury, or physical malformation of fingers, wrist, hands, ears or forehead/skull or other sensor sites which would limit the ability to test sites needed for the study. 4.(Note: Certain malformations may still allow to participate if the condition is noted and would not affect the particular sites utilized.) 5.Having recent medical tests done that included an injection of dyes, Mag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) or Computed Tomography (CT) environment. 6.Female participants of childbearing potential having positive UPT at the time of screening. 7.Nursing female participants. 8.Participants with known respiratory conditions such as: (self-reported/ clinical history) a.Uncontrolled / severe asthma b.Flu c.Pneumonia / bronchitis d.Shortness of breath / respiratory distress e.Unresolved respiratory or lung surgery with continued indications of health issues f.Emphysema, COPD, lung disease 9.Participants with known heart or cardiovascular conditions such as: (self-reported/ clinical history, except for blood pressure and ECG review) a.Hypertension: systolic >140mmHg, Diastolic >90mmHg on 3 consecutive readings (reviewed during health screen). b.Have had cardiovascular surgery c.Chest pain (angina) d.Heart rhythms other than a normal sinus rhythm or with respiratory sinus arrhythmia (reviewed during health screen) e.Previous heart attack f.Blocked artery g.Unexplained shortness of breath h.Congestive heart failure (CHF) i.History of stroke j.Transient ischemic attack k.Carotid artery disease l.Myocardial ischemia m.Myocardial infarction n.Cardiomyopathy 10.Participants with following health conditions (self-reported/ clinical history) a.Diabetes b.Uncontrolled thyroid disease c.Kidney disease / chronic renal impairment d.History of seizures (except childhood febrile seizures) e.Epilepsy f.History of unexplained syncope g.Recent history of frequent migraine headaches h.Recent symptomatic head injury (within the last 2 months) i.Cancer / chemotherapy 11.Participants with known clotting disorders (self-reported/ clinical history) a. a.History of bleeding disorders or personal history of prolonged bleeding from injury b.History of blood clots c.Hemophilia d.Current use of blood thinner: prescription or daily use of aspirin 12.Participants with severe contact allergies (self-reported/ clinical history) to standard adhesives, latex or other materials found in pulse oximetry sensors. 13.Participants having failure of the Perfusion Index Ulnar/Ulnar+Radial Ratio test (Ratio less than 0.4) 14.Participants having unwillingness or inability to remove colored nail polish from test digits/ fingers. 15.Participants with any other condition, which as per the investigator would jeopardize the outcome of the trial. 16.Participants who are not willing to follow study procedures.
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Accuracy of pulse-oximeters SpO2 measurements versus arterial blood co-oximetry (SaO2). The Accuracy Root Mean Square (ARMS) performance of the investigational Pulse Oximeter will meet a specification of 3 or lower in non-motion conditions for the range of 70 - 100% SaO2.Timepoint: 1 day | — |
